Piper Chapman is a public relations executive with a career and a fiance when her past suddenly catches up to her. In her mid-30s she is sentenced to spend time in a minimum-security women's prison in Connecticut for her association with a drug runner 10 years earlier. This Netflix original series is based on the book of the same title. Forced to trade power suits for prison orange, Chapman makes her way through the corrections system and adjusts to life behind bars, making friends with the many eccentric, unusual and unexpected people she meets.

Critics Consensus

With a talented ensemble cast bringing life to a fresh round of serial drama, Orange Is the New Black's sophomore season lives up to its predecessor's standard for female-led television excellence.

Episodes

Episode 1 Aired Jun 6, 2014 Thirsty Bird Piper's world is turned upside down when she's forced to confront the consequences of her actions and face new challenges. Details Episode 2 Aired Jun 6, 2014 Looks Blue, Tastes Red A mock Job Fair provides Taystee with a chance to show off her business smarts; Red feels isolated from her prison family. Details Episode 3 Aired Jun 6, 2014 Hugs Can Be Deceiving Piper is challenged by her Soso experience; Morello gets her heart broken; a figure from Taystee's past arrives to disturb the status quo. Details Episode 4 Aired Jun 6, 2014 A Whole Other Hole Sophia gives the women a much-needed lesson in the female anatomy; Morello takes a detour; Larry makes some life changes. Details Episode 5 Aired Jun 6, 2014 Low Self Esteem City A bathroom turf war sees deeper lines drawn in the sand as Gloria and Vee go head to head; Piper receives devastating news. Details Episode 6 Aired Jun 6, 2014 You Also Have a Pizza Love is in the air as the inmates prepare for a Valentine's Day party; Red makes an intriguing new discovery; Larry asks Piper to be his prison mole. Details Episode 7 Aired Jun 6, 2014 Comic Sans Piper starts a prison newsletter with the help of Healy and a few other inmates; Vee launches an entrepreneurial enterprise. Details Episode 8 Aired Jun 6, 2014 Appropriately Sized Pots Piper faces a new backlash over special privileges; Caputo feels pressure to toughen up, resulting in administrative changes. Details Episode 9 Aired Jun 6, 2014 40 Oz. of Furlough Piper's relationship with Larry faces a real-world test; Red's effort to redeem herself is finally rewarded; a familiar figure returns to Litchfield. Details Episode 10 Aired Jun 6, 2014 Little Mustachioed S... The guards get tougher in a bid to turn up prison contraband; a big, lingering secret is finally revealed. Details Episode 11 Aired Jun 6, 2014 Take a Break From Your Values Piper is shocked at an unexpected change in her status; Soso's hunger strike attracts new support that takes on a religious fervor. Details Episode 12 Aired Jun 6, 2014 It Was the Change Tensions run high as a prison power outage forces several issues to come to light; Piper finds herself compromised and is forced to think on her feet. Details Episode 13 Aired Jun 6, 2014 We Have Manners. We're Polite. Several futures hang in the balance as the inmates face and confront their worst nightmares; life will never be the same again.
